Cui Jian is known as the godfather of Chinese rock music whose song Nothing to My Name became the unofficial anthem of the Tiananmen Square protests of 1989.

The 47-year-old rock singer says he is backing the Olympics but will remain true to the spirit of rock-and-roll.

He tells Al Jazeera that making trouble is the job of a rock-and-roll star.
